移动分区后修复 Windows EFI

移动分区后修复 Windows EFI

我有两个硬盘,第一个有一个 EFI 分区和一个 Windows 分区,第二个没有分区。

我想将 Windows 分区移到第二个硬盘的中间,并从那里启动。很可能我必须修复 EFI(BCD)之后。

我的问题是:

  1. “我可以” / “我是否需要” 将 EFI 分区“移动” / “克隆” 到新的 HDD 上?
  2. 我是否需要从第一个硬盘中删除 Windows 安装才能修复第二个硬盘,或者我可以让两个硬盘都正常工作?
  3. 假如说:

    1. 我可以使用以下方法复制 Windows 分区分区(气缸对准)以及可能的 EFI,
    2. 我已准备好恢复 U 盘,
    3. 我已经备份了,

    这个计划是否存在漏洞,会彻底毁掉我的电脑?

答案1

Windows 启动管理器可以并且将从任何分区或磁盘启动任何 Windows 7-10。

EFI 的启动顺序从固件开始,固件会加载第一个启动候选程序 - 通常从第一个 GPT 磁盘上的 EFI 系统分区加载。在本例中,它是 Windows 启动管理器。

启动管理器读取 BCD 并显示启动菜单。启动菜单中的每个项目都链接到一个加载程序 (winload.exe),该加载程序位于我们安装 Windows 的驱动器上的 \windows\system32 中。

总结一下 - 您将 Windows 安装从一个分区复制到另一个分区,然后修改 BCD 加载器路径(驱动器号)。您还必须修复系统根目录的驱动器号。

建议工具 -可视化 BCD 编辑器

相关内容